Browse, get, and manage SPICE kernels and metakernels across NASA and ESA mission archives.

⚠️ CRITICAL: Update to v0.10.0 or later. Versions before 0.10.0 contained a fuzzy filename matching bug that could silently create symlinks between completely different SPICE kernel files, causing silent scientific data corruption — SPICE loads valid but wrong data with no errors. All users who used spice-kernel-db get or spice-kernel-db update are affected, regardless of the dedup setting — the symlink creation code did not honor the per-mission dedup flag (also fixed in 0.10.0). Users who only used scan and resolve are not affected. After updating, remove all symlinks in your kernel directories and re-run spice-kernel-db update. See CHANGELOG.md for recovery steps.

What this tool does

  1. Mission setup: Configure missions from NASA NAIF or ESA SPICE servers with an interactive dialog.

  2. Browse & get: Browse available metakernels for a mission, then get one — the tool downloads all missing kernels automatically and makes the metakernel ready to use locally.

  3. Metakernel rewriting: Rewrites .tm files for local use with minimal edits — only PATH_VALUES is changed, everything else stays identical to the original. A symlink tree bridges the gap between where the metakernel expects files and where they actually live on disk.

  4. Deduplication (optional): Identifies identical kernel files across missions using SHA-256 hashing and replaces duplicates with symlinks. Per-mission opt-in — you can deduplicate some missions while keeping others untouched.

Installation

pip install spice-kernel-db

Or with conda:

conda install -c michaelaye spice-kernel-db

Or from source:

git clone https://github.com/michaelaye/spice-kernel-db
cd spice-kernel-db
pip install -e ".[dev]"

Quick start

Set up a mission

spice-kernel-db mission add

Interactive dialog: choose a server (NASA NAIF / ESA SPICE) → pick a mission from the list → configure deduplication preference.

Browse available metakernels

spice-kernel-db browse JUICE

Shows all .tm files in the mission's remote mk/ directory, grouped by base name with version counts.

Get a metakernel

spice-kernel-db get juice_ops.tm

Downloads the metakernel, checks which kernels you already have, downloads the missing ones in parallel, and creates symlinks so the .tm file works immediately.

Use with spiceypy

import spiceypy as spice
from spice_kernel_db import KernelDB

db = KernelDB()
mks = db.list_metakernels(mission="JUICE")
spice.furnsh(mks[0]["mk_path"])

Python API

from spice_kernel_db import KernelDB

db = KernelDB()

# Browse remote metakernels
db.browse_remote_metakernels(
    "https://naif.jpl.nasa.gov/pub/naif/JUICE/kernels/mk/",
    mission="JUICE",
)

# Get a metakernel (downloads missing kernels automatically)
db.get_metakernel(
    "https://naif.jpl.nasa.gov/pub/naif/JUICE/kernels/mk/juice_ops.tm",
    mission="JUICE",
)

# Optionally deduplicate across missions
db.deduplicate_with_symlinks(dry_run=True)   # preview
db.deduplicate_with_symlinks(dry_run=False)  # execute

Supported servers

Server URL
NASA NAIF https://naif.jpl.nasa.gov/pub/naif/
ESA SPICE https://spiftp.esac.esa.int/data/SPICE/

Both use the same <server>/<MISSION>/kernels/mk/ directory structure.
